Bobb is an Emmy Award-nominated sound designer and re-recording mixer based in New York with over a decade of experience. An alumnus of NYU's Tisch School of the Arts, he has dedicated his life to the art of sound.

With a body of work that spans everything from Super Bowl commercials to children’s shows to Oscar-nominated films, he has developed a versatile ear for story, tone, and balance. His television work has been featured on Nickelodeon, NBC, Amazon, and Netflix, and his film work has been displayed at hundreds of festivals around the world, including Sundance, Berlinale, Slamdance, Tribeca, and SXSW. In 2018 he was nominated for an Emmy for Outstanding Sound Editing in a Preschool Animated Program for his work on Amazon’s Click Clack Moo: Christmas at the Farm. In 2023, the documentary short film Stranger at the Gate, which he sound designed, was nominated for an Academy Award. His latest work, Hundreds of Beavers, is a dialogue-free sound design showcase and currently stands among the highest rated films of 2024 on Rotten Tomatoes.

Bobb is also an award-winning director, writer, musician, and painter. His latest short film, Light My Fire, was awarded Best Director at the BlueCat Short Film Festival and is featured on Short of the Week and Omeleto. He also produces and plays drums for indie rock band Proper Youth.
